H.RES.1461: Supporting Olympic Day on June 23, 2010, and congratulating Team USA and World Fit participants.
About This Bill
- This bill was introduced in the 111th Congress
- This bill is primarily about sports and recreation
- Introduced June 22, 2010
- Latest Major Action Dec. 22, 2010
Bill Sponsor
Bill Cosponsors
52 (35 Democrats, 17 Republicans)
Bill Summary
Expresses support for: (1) Olympic Day and the goals that Olympic Day pursues; and (2) the goals of World Fit.Congratulates: (1) Team USA on their Vancouver 2010 accomplishments; and (2) World Fit's participants on the 2010 results.
